The major characteristic of recent health and social problems in Greenland are (compared to Denmark): low mean lifetime expectancy, high infant mortality, increasing rates of diabetes, cardiovascular diseases and cancer, high rate of infectious diseases (tuberculosis, HIV, hepatitis B virus infection, Helicobacter pylori infection, meningitis), high rate of suicide, high rate of lethal accidents, high rate of legal abortions, domestic violence, tobacco, alcohol and drug abuse, mental health are stressed by unstable family relationships, contamination of the traditional diet (Chief Medical Officer 2000) . cord-016593-t0dn27bc 2009 Their understanding of food sovereignty includes: a.) local production and trade of agricultural products with access to land, water, native seeds, credits, technical support and financial facilities for all participants; b.) women are the main food producers worldwide 1) and they are often in charge of transformation and local trade; c.) therefore, access to land, credit and basic production means for women and girls at home and in the community is a guarantee of food security, but it is also able to overcome the violent and unjust patriarchal structures within families, communities, social organizations, countries, and global economic systems; d.) inclusion of the indigenous, women, and peasants in regional and national rural policy and decision-making processes related to agriculture and food sovereignty; e.) the basic right to consume safe, sufficient, and culturally accepted non-toxic food, locally produced, transformed and sold, since food is more than intake of proteins and calories: it is a cultural act of life; f.) the rights of regions and nations to establish compensations and subsidies to get protection from dumping and artificial low prices as a result of subsidies in industrialized countries; g.) the obligation of national and local governments to improve the food disposal of its citizens through stimulus of production and transformation of food, subsidies, and economic programmes to achieve food sovereignty in basic crops; discounts in urban poor regions, able to guarantee the basic food basket; popular kitchens; breakfast in schools, and special food for undernourished babies and pregnant mothers; cord-016840-p3sq99yg 2008 Complex emergencies (CEs) can occur anywhere and are defined as crisis situations that greatly elevate the risk to nutrition and overall health (morbidity and mortality) of older individuals in the affected area. The major underlying threats to nutritional status for older adults during CEs are food insecurity, inadequate social support, and lack of access to health services. At the international level, the most significant step has been the adoption of 17 sustainable development goals (SDGs) by the United Nations General Assembly, with SDG 12 seeking to "ensure sustainable consumption and production patterns." More specifically, the third target under this goal (Target 12.3) calls for halving per capita global food waste at the retail and consumer levels and reducing food losses along production and supply chains (including postharvest losses) by 2030. cord-266746-c0urbl6l 2016 Overall, increased global demand for animal-based products requires a substantially greater increase in plant and other feed resources, which will subsequently generate a much larger volume of protein-rich materials than currently produced. Since then, concern over the risks posed by ABPs, including infectious diseases (such as swine fever, foot and mouth) and other contaminants (such as dioxins), to human and animal health, has resulted in strict regulations regarding their safe handling and disposal (cunningham, 2003 ; department for environment Food and rural Affairs, 2011). As such, most countries now have local regulations put in place that are typically broad in scope and directly affect any person or business that generates, uses, disposes, stores, handles, or transports food waste containing animal products and ABPs derived from the food processing industry. The regulations also control the use of ABPs as feed, fertilizer, and technical products with rules for their transformation via composting and biogas operations and their disposal via rendering and incineration (department for environment Food and rural Affairs, 2011). cord-267650-lcvbaguj 1998 title: Postnatal Maturation of Rat Small Intestinal Brush Border Membranes Correlates with Increase in Food Protein Binding Capacity To investigate maturational changes of membranefood protein binding capacity, we studied bindingcharacteristics of brush border membranes isolated fromsmall intestines of newborn and adult rats. Greenhouses is a type of farming that can provide the option to connect with renewable energy resources in order to increase the sustainability of such systems and the energy efficiency of the various treatments that are necessary for mass food production (Manos and Xydis, 2019) . Indoor vertical farming is an innovative type of closed plant production system that provides the opportunity of a controlled-environment agriculture, which can be controlled according to the crop regardless of the weather conditions. In addition to the hydroponic systems that recirculate the nutrient solution and benefit greenhouse cultivations, vertical farms use systems that condense and collect the water that is transpired by plants at the cooling panel of the air conditioners and continuously recycle and reuse it for irrigation. cord-342463-rc4epbnn 2020 cord-342755-4jx0h0y5 2020 Food security in the context on COVID-19 was high on the agenda at the Ninth Special Emergency Meeting of the Conference of Heads of Government of CARICOM on April 15, 2020, focusing on a regional approach instead of individual country approaches (4, 5) . The butyric anaerobes, as these three Clostridium species causing spoilage in low-acid canned foods, are usually associated with spoilage of products with pH values between 3.9 and 4.5 producing blown cans and a butyric odor (Hersom & Hulland, 1980) . Diarrheal disease is often associated with protein rich foods (meat, vegetables, puddings, and milk products) and is thought to be caused by vegetative cells (ingested as viable cells or spores) that produce enterotoxins in the small intestine (Abee et al., 2011) . cord-345681-sj0ypr2c 2020 Health care practitioners have surfaced as front-line workers addressing the urgent needs of the COVID-19 pandemic, and there remains much ground to gain in terms of providing adequate support and protection for these groups (5) .
